Share That Video!

You already knew this…
StorySlab makes your videos and animations infinitely more portable and easy to share with a prospect. What a good way to leverage your investment in video!
But did you know…
Videos in StorySlab are stored 100% on the device for instantaneous playback and no internet connection required.
StorySlab now enables you to share videos by emailing a link. Your salespeople can show the video in person and then share it with a personalized email.
